It’s not easy finding the right balance of aggression and style with aftermarket upgrades, but Techart just might have it with this new Porsche Cayenne body kit. Simply called the Aero Kit I, it’s designed specifically for facelifted third-generation (E3) models. The changes are subtle, but the impact is noticeable.
At the front, you’ll find a modest chin spoiler at the base of the fascia. It adds winglets on the edges, complementing new rocker trim also has winglets ahead of the rear wheels. There are more winglets at the back, part of a tweaked rear fascia that adds a diffuser. Further up are small lip spoilers for the hatch, and there’s a new carbon fiber hood that accentuates the Cayenne’s existing body lines from the grille to the windshield.
Techart
According to Techart, the upgrades go beyond visual appeal. The company says aerodynamics are better balanced with the kit, and handling is improved as well. There aren’t any specifics to back up those claims, but how many people are taking their Cayennes to the track? Honestly, we’re in this purely for the aesthetics.
If you do want more, Techart reminds us there are wheel upgrades and a throaty exhaust system that puts more bass in the Cayenne’s voice. The tuner also has a performance kit that adds as much as 66 horsepower under the hood.
A bit more power might be desirable if you have a base model Cayenne, but there’s still 348 hp on tap from its turbocharged 3.0-liter V-6 in stock trim. The other end of the spectrum is the bonkers 729-hp Turbo E-Hybrid, a vehicle in which you probably won’t notice a few extra ponies.
Techart will announce pricing and availability for the body kit at a later date.

Introduction
Prepare to witness automotive excellence in its purest form as we delve into the world of the 2024 BMW M4. This highly anticipated sports coupe combines exhilarating performance, cutting-edge technology, and an undeniable presence that will leave an indelible mark on the automotive landscape.
Unleashing:Power and Precision
At the heart of the M4 lies a masterpiece of engineering – a 3.0-liter twin-turbocharged inline-six engine that unleashes a symphony of power and refinement. With 503 horsepower and 479 lb-ft of torque on tap, the M4 accelerates from 0 to 60 mph in a blistering 3.8 seconds. Its lightning-fast 8-speed M Steptronic transmission ensures seamless gear changes and an unparalleled driving experience.
Exceptional
Handling and Dynamics
Beyond its raw power, the M4 boasts exceptional handling and dynamics. Its Adaptive M Suspension expertly manages the balance between comfort and agility, providing precise cornering and a thrilling driving experience. The M Compound brakes offer unmatched stopping power, instilling confidence in every maneuver.
Aerodynamic
Perfection
The M4's sleek and aggressive exterior is not merely for aesthetics; it also serves a functional purpose. Its aerodynamic design, including a prominent front splitter, side skirts, and a rear diffuser, optimizes airflow and enhances stability at high speeds.
Advanced
Technology and Connectivity
Inside the M4's cockpit, you'll find a driver-centric environment that seamlessly blends luxury and functionality. The BMW Live Cockpit Professional features a fully digital instrument cluster and a high-resolution central display, providing all the necessary information at a glance. iDrive 8, BMW's latest infotainment system, offers intuitive controls and a wide range of connectivity options.
Striking
Design and Customization
The 2024 M4 turns heads wherever it goes, thanks to its striking design. Its muscular stance, sleek lines, and iconic kidney grille exude an aura of power and sophistication. A wide range of customization options, including various paint finishes, wheel designs, and interior trims, allows you to tailor the M4 to your unique style.
Conclusion
The 2024 BMW M4 is not just a car; it is a statement of automotive passion and engineering prowess. Its exhilarating performance, precision handling, and advanced technology combine to create an unparalleled driving experience. Whether you're navigating winding roads or hitting the track, the M4 delivers an unforgettable symphony of power, precision, and exhilaration.
